This paper aims at an understanding of acquisition processes in a strongly industrialized and export-oriented economy in Central Europe. Drawing on a proximity framework and behaviour theory, the paper investigates that the geographical proximity dimension is more influential than the cognitive proximity dimension. At the same time, cognitive proximity matters more for foreign firms investing into the economy than for domestic acquisitions. While the role of cognitive proximity diminished during the economic crisis, geographical proximity keeps its importance throughout the economic cycle. Moreover, cognitive proximity has become more important for acquisitions of large companies and less for SMEs.  相似文献

多模态磁共振神经影像技术的发展为大脑工作原理研究及脑部疾病早期诊断提供了新的手段。当前多数神经精神性疾病的诊断仅依据其临床症状,缺少客观的神经影像生物学标志物。传统的基于组间比较的单变量分析仅能在组间水平进行推断,无法提供个体水平的诊断和预测,临床应用价值非常有限。机器学习技术可在不同水平对神经影像进行计算分析和研究,发现其中规律从而有效预测和分类未知数据,找出与脑疾病高度相关的脑区特征,提供个体水平的诊断并探测脑疾病的病理生理机制。本文对基于机器学习的神经影像分析步骤及机器学习在神经精神疾病智能诊断及预测研究中的应用进行综述,并对未来研究发展进行展望。  相似文献

Project learning is a function of individuals’ internal cognitive processes, interpretation and integration of learning at the team and project level, and the organization's ability to institutionalize learning into practices. However, understanding of how learning unfolds between these levels remains limited. Using a single in-depth case study, this paper reports on how learning occurs between levels in a global project-based organization (PBO). Six bridging mechanisms are identified: (1) networks, (2) organizational initiatives, (3) power and politics, (4) coaching and mentoring, (5) culture of empowerment, and (6) temporality. The temporal nature of the projects paired with the global context offers the opportunity for a stable workforce to be deployed across geographical regions to form formal and informal networks that offer a parallel organizational structure for multilevel learning. Project managers (PMs), senior leaders and the project management office (PMO) engage differently in the learning process, depending on their degree of connectivity and power within the global organization.  相似文献

本文首先介绍大卫·科尔布的经验认知和学习模式理论,分析比较了有关研究在建筑设计课中的运用成果,特别是唐纳德·舍恩对建筑设计室教学基本方式的研究。本文指出,设计室教学法强调知识的操作转型而忽视了知识理解和成形。本文强调对学生个性和学习模式的多样性的认识的重要性,主张设计课的改革应从以学生为中心的学习模式的研究开始。  相似文献

A new multiwavelet neural network‐based response surface method is proposed for efficient structural reliability assessment. Although multiwavelet network can be used for approximating nonlinear functions, its application has been limited to small dimension problems due to computational cost. The new method expands the application of multiwavelet network to moderate dimension by introducing a series of intermediate nodes, and the number of these intermediate nodes is determined by the multiwavelet theory. Thus, a multidimensional function learning problem is transformed into a one‐dimensional function learning problem. Four examples involving one stochastic finite element‐based reliability problem illustrate the effectiveness of the proposed method, which indicate that the new method is more efficient up to 10 random variables than the classical multilayer perceptron‐based response surface method.  相似文献

天津大学建筑学院在建筑设计基础课程中,通过借鉴认知学理论和研究性学习理论,设立以空间为核心的空间认知与设计训练系列教学单元,进行相关教学实践。教学单元系列由人体尺度认知、城市认知与分析、经典建筑作品学习与分析、立方体空间设计、空间组合和空间建造六个单元组成,形成符合学生认知特点的序列,同时在教学中贯穿以研究性学习为主体的学习方法,取得了很好的教学效果。  相似文献

Benthic macroinvertebrate communities in stream ecosystems were assessed hierarchically through two-level classification methods of unsupervised learning. Two artificial neural networks were implemented in combination. Firstly, the self-organizing map (SOM) was used to reduce the dimension of community data, and secondly, the adaptive resonance theory (ART) was subsequently applied to the SOM to further classify the groups in different scales. Hierarchical grouping in community data efficiently reflected the impact of the environmental factors such as topographic conditions, levels of pollution, and sampling location and time across different scales. New community data not included in the training process were used to test the trained network model. The input data were appropriately grouped at different hierarchical levels by the trained networks, and correspondingly revealed the impact of environmental disturbances and temporal dynamics of communities. The hierarchical clusters based on a two-level classification method could be useful for assessing ecosystem quality and community variations caused by environmental disturbances.  相似文献

通过剖析建筑施工技术课程特点,借鉴加拿大外语教学"浸入式"教学法概念,分析了建立"浸入式"教学环境的必要性,提出了构建直接"浸入式"教学环境与间接"浸入式"教学环境的具体方法。构建"浸入式"教学环境有助于学生始终处于建筑施工现场学习理论知识,缩短认知进程,提高课程学习效果。  相似文献

20世纪60年代末以来西方教育界所兴起的建构主义学习理论是一种培养人的创造性能力的认知理论。它强调的是以学习者为中心、学习者的主观体验、知识的建构机制和学习境脉的真实性。它主要关注如何为学习者提供自主学习的支撑性条件而非现成的知识。这种新的学习环境设计的理念也必将引起我们在校园规划和教学建筑设计中的重新思考和进一步探索。该文尝试以此理论为立足点,结合具体设计案例,对建构主义的学习环境和学习空间设计进行一次探讨,为实现传统学校建筑设计的转变提供可资借鉴的解决方案与方法策略。  相似文献
